Growth across the vehicle recycling industry is supported by increasingly stringent end-of-life vehicle (ELV) regulations, rising electric vehicle adoption, and stronger demand for recovered ferrous and non-ferrous metals from manufacturing industries. The continued expansion of electric vehicle fleets is creating new opportunities for recovering valuable battery materials, adding an important source of revenue for recyclers. Regulatory initiatives remain one of the strongest factors encouraging the development of organized vehicle recycling operations worldwide, as governments continue to strengthen requirements related to end-of-life vehicle processing and resource recovery. Since 2022, more than 30 policy measures focused on critical mineral recycling have been introduced globally, supporting the transition toward more structured recycling practices. Despite these favorable developments, the presence of informal recycling operations continues to limit the expansion of organized market participants in several regions. Informal recyclers often operate with lower compliance costs, allowing them to offer more competitive pricing for scrap materials and reusable vehicle components. As environmental standards continue to evolve and demand for recycled materials increases, the global vehicle recycling market is expected to benefit from greater investment in formal recycling infrastructure and improved resource recovery capabilities.
The passenger car segment held 72.4% share, generating USD 64.3 billion in 2025. The segment maintains its leading position because passenger cars represent the largest share of vehicles in operation worldwide. Established dismantling and material recovery processes for conventional light vehicles also contribute to higher operational efficiency, enabling recyclers to process large volumes while maximizing material recovery and supporting consistent revenue generation across the segment.
The ICE vehicle segment represented 79.7% share in 2025, reaching USD 70.8 billion. This leadership reflects the continued dominance of internal combustion engine vehicles within the global vehicle fleet and the maturity of recycling systems designed specifically for conventional powertrains. Well-established dismantling processes, optimized recovery operations, and efficient material separation continue to support the economic viability of recycling ICE vehicles. The existing processing infrastructure also enables recyclers to recover valuable automotive materials efficiently, reinforcing the segment's substantial contribution to overall market revenue.
United States Vehicle Recycling Market reached USD 31.5 billion in 2025. Market growth continues to be supported by one of the world's largest populations of aging passenger vehicles, creating a consistent supply of end-of-life vehicles for processing. The country's well-developed formal recycling infrastructure, combined with strong integration between vehicle recyclers and metal processing facilities, continues to strengthen material recovery efficiency and support the long-term expansion of the vehicle recycling market.
